The NFL Rivalry jerseys for 2026 are officially here. Nike and the NFL unveiled eight new uniforms on August 25 for teams in the NFC North and AFC South, expanding the Rivalries program for its second season.
The Chicago Bears, Detroit Lions, Green Bay Packers, Minnesota Vikings, Houston Texans, Indianapolis Colts, Jacksonville Jaguars and Tennessee Titans make up the new 2026 class. Each team will debut its special uniform at home against a division rival between Week 3 and Week 16.
NFL Rivalry Jerseys 2026: All 8 Debut Games
Indianapolis Colts — Week 3 vs. Houston, Sept. 27: Indianapolis opens the rollout with anthracite, dark gray and glossy-black elements around its traditional striping. Horseshoe, ironwork and anvil-inspired details preserve the Colts identity, while “For the Shoe” appears on the back neckline.
Green Bay Packers — Week 5 vs. Chicago, Oct. 11: Green Bay combines vintage green with an alabaster palette and retro-style “GB” branding. Details reference the franchise’s community ownership and six historic stock sales, while “Making history since 1919” appears at the neckline.
Detroit Lions — Week 8 vs. Minnesota, Nov. 1: Detroit uses a primarily white design with Honolulu blue, carbon-fiber-inspired numbers and lion-eye shoulder details. The look connects the franchise with the city’s automotive and racing heritage.
Jacksonville Jaguars — Week 8 vs. Indianapolis, Nov. 1: Jacksonville mixes a cream base with custom Jaguars script, chrome accents, dimensional numbers and jaguar-print details inspired by Florida’s coastal culture.

Titans, Texans and Vikings Highlight Local Identity
Tennessee Titans — Week 10 vs. Jacksonville, Nov. 15: Nashville’s music heritage shapes a navy uniform with Titans Blue accents, neon-inspired numbers and six darker shoulder stripes designed to reference guitar strings.
Houston Texans — Week 11 vs. Indianapolis, Nov. 19: Houston gets an all-white “iced out” look featuring metallic and chrome-inspired finishes. Its blue numbers reference the city’s “Be Someone” bridge, while other details draw from H-Town street and custom-car culture.
Minnesota Vikings — Week 15 vs. Detroit, Dec. 20: Minnesota introduces a deeper purple paired with ivory, carved-style numbers and Viking Knot imagery. References to the Gjallarhorn and longship tradition reinforce the Nordic theme.
Chicago Bears Save Their New Look for Christmas Day
Chicago Bears — Week 16 vs. Green Bay, Dec. 25: Chicago will be the final new team to debut its Rivalries uniform. The Bears use a midnight-colored base, burnt-orange accents and bold orange pants.
The design includes sleeve striping influenced by classic Bears uniforms and the four stars of the Chicago flag. A George Halas tribute patch appears on the front, while “Monsters of the Midway” is featured at the back neckline.

Why the 2026 Rivalries Uniforms Stand Out
The designs are intended to represent more than alternate colors. Detroit references automotive culture, Tennessee leans into Nashville music, Houston incorporates its car and street scenes, while Green Bay and Chicago emphasize franchise history.
The Rivalries program began in 2025 with AFC East and NFC West teams. Nike says that first merchandise launch became Fanatics’ best-selling release to date. The official Nike 2026 Rivalries announcement confirms that each new uniform will remain in its team’s rotation for three years alongside existing alternate looks.
2025 Rivalries Teams Return This Season
Arizona, Buffalo, New England, San Francisco, Seattle, the Los Angeles Rams, New York Jets and Miami will continue wearing their 2025 Rivalries designs for selected divisional games in 2026.
Week 16 will bring a program first when Seattle and the Los Angeles Rams both wear their Rivalries uniforms in the same matchup, creating the first dual-Rivalries game.
When Do NFL Rivalry Jerseys Go on Sale?
The eight new jerseys and matching fan gear are scheduled to go on sale September 1, 2026 through Nike, NFL Shop, Fanatics, team stores and selected retailers, with international availability planned as well.

Which NFL Divisions Get Rivalries Uniforms Next?
The rollout continues with the NFC East and AFC West in 2027, followed by the NFC South and AFC North in 2028. The phased schedule eventually gives every NFL division its own Rivalries collection.
For 2026, the major change is scale: all 16 teams introduced during the program’s first two years are scheduled to wear Rivalries uniforms, while the eight new designs add extra significance to divisional games from September through December.
